D'Arcy W. Doyle
"For Keeps"
Lithograph On Paper
Signed Lower Right In Watercolour

Overview
A Charming Lithographic Study Of Colonial-Era Australian Rural Life, "For Keeps" Captures An Intimate Moment In A Frontier Settlement. The Composition Depicts A Baker'S Cart Positioned Prominently In The Foreground Of A Dusty Township Street, With Children At Play Scattered Across The Red Earth. A Weatherboard Residence With Characteristic Period Architecture Dominates The Right Side Of The Composition, Whilst A Telegraph Pole And Distant Mountains Establish The Landscape Context. The Artist'S Attention To Architectural Detail And Community Activity Is Evident Throughout, With Careful Rendering Of The Building'S Latticed Verandah, The Horse-Drawn Cart'S Construction, And The Informal Gathering Of Figures That Animate The Scene.

D'Arcy W. Doyle'S Artistic Practice Focused On The Documentation Of Australian Colonial Settlements And Outback Communities. His Lithographic Works Demonstrate A Sophisticated Understanding Of Light, Atmosphere, And Social Narrative, Rendering Everyday Scenes With Both Technical Precision And Human Warmth. "For Keeps" Exemplifies His Characteristic Approach: Meticulous Architectural Rendering Combined With Observed Moments Of Community Life, Creating A Visual Record Of A Vanished Era.
